Abstract The present work is devoted to investigate in some details the e.m.f. and kinetic studies concerning the ion—paii’ing effects on the rate of aquation of both chioro— and bromopentamniinecobalt (III) ions in different dicarbozcylate media containing 10% (v/v) of dioxane at five different temperatures. The thesis comprises three chapters. The first chapter deals with a general survey on the effect of ion—association on the rate of chemical reaction with special interest to the aquat ion of halogen— opentamxninecobalt(III) and Or(Ifl) complex iom in different media while the aim of investigation and the statment of the problem are put prior to this chapter. The second chapter describe the methods of preparation of the Co(III)— coraplezces aM the reçuired solutions beside the details of the experiraental techniques for both equilibrium and kinetic studies. The third chapter give the detailed results of the e.ra.f. aM kinetic studies with a conipereheusive discussions. This chapter is subdivided into two essential parts. The first part is concerned with the electromotive force measurenients utilized for the determination of the first and the second dissociation constants and 1(2) of five different dicaitolic acids (in 10% dioxane) namely, succinic, tartaric, malonic, maleic and phthalic at five. |
